The LM4670ITL is a high-performance audio amplifier from the reputable semiconductor manufacturer, Texas Instruments. Designed for portable and space-constrained applications, this amplifier is a part of TI's extensive range of audio solutions that deliver high-quality sound reproduction with minimal power consumption.
Key Features
- Output Power: The LM4670ITL is capable of delivering 2.5W of continuous average power to a 4Ω load with less than 10% Total Harmonic Distortion plus Noise (THD+N) from a 5V power supply, making it ideal for mobile phones, tablets, and other personal electronics that demand quality audio output.
- Efficiency: This amplifier is designed with TI's state-of-the-art 3D enhancement process, which significantly improves efficiency, reducing the need for heat sinks and allowing for a more compact design.
- Space-Saving Design: The LM4670ITL comes in a tiny 9-bump micro SMD package, making it perfect for applications where space is at a premium.
- Advanced Features: It includes features such as a low-power shutdown mode, thermal shutdown protection, and an externally controlled gain with minimal external components required.

Technical Specifications
The amplifier operates over a wide power supply range from 2.4V to 5.5V, which allows for flexible integration into various system designs. It also features a low quiescent current and a fast start-up time of only 15ms, ensuring prompt response to audio playback commands.
